A 4.6L Terminator Mustang Wearing a 1969 Suit
Instead of starting from the ground up with a fully custom vehicle, one builder decided to approach the restomod project by fitting a classic Mustang body onto a 2003 SVT Cobra platform.
Cobra Underneath
The gorgeous dark metallic grey Mustang you see featured in the photos above may not look like anything but a beautifully restored and modified 1969 pony car. But in reality, it's a 2003 Mustang SVT Cobra that wears a '69 Mustang shell. It's practically impossible for passers-by to discover this car's true nature from the outside, which is a testament to the quality of the build.

The only way to uncover this restomod's true nature would be to look beneath the surface, peeking into the interior and popping the hood. The re-skinned Terminator was recently listed on the UK-based auction site The Market, and it sold for a sum of £55,500, which equates to about $75,000 with current exchange rates.
Supercharged Terminator
The high-performance Mustang's well-known 4.6-liter V8 is capable of 390 horsepower from the factory. Through the process of this build, however, a number of power-adding modifications have been worked into the motor, including a 2.6L Kenne Bell supercharger. All told, the upgrades bring the car's power output to a gnarly 688 horses.
Capable Drivetrain
The power is directed down via a T-56 six-speed manual transmission, and then onto an 8.8-inch rear end with 3.55 gears, before making its way down to the rear wheels. Speaking of the wheels, the set of 18x9 Mogul Racing MR-7 alloy wheels are wrapped in sticky 285/35ZR18 Hankook Ventus S1 Noble2 tires.
2003 Mustang Interior
The cabin of the 2003 Mustang SVT Cobra remains largely unchanged from the factory. That is, of course, with the exception of a boost gauge, which is a bi-product of adding in the supercharger.
Exterior Modifications
The beautiful exterior features a Subaru dark metallic grey paint that is accented by lighter color markings on the body sides. The gunmetal grey wheels add to the charismatic appearance, as well. The custom chin spoiler, dual hood scoops, and rear wing add subtle but effective touches of sportiness to match the Mustang's hidden power.
